Male flowers look different that other papaya flowers because they grow in large numbers on drooping stalks, known as peduncle. Since male papaya flowers don’t have ovaries, they can’t produce fruit. They have stamens that bear the pollen that pollinates the flowers with ovaries. The flowers are thinner than females, with a tubular shape.
